Kraken — D&D 5e Stat Block
Complete stat block for Kraken, a CR 23 gargantuan monstrosity from D&D 5th Edition.
Kraken
Gargantuan Monstrosity, Chaotic Evil
Armor Class 18 (natural armor)
Hit Points 472 (27d20+189)
Speed 20 ft., swim 60 ft.
Damage Immunities lightning; bludgeoning, piercing, and slashing from nonmagical attacks
Condition Immunities frightened, paralyzed
Senses Truesight 120 ft., passive Perception 14
Languages Abyssal, Celestial, Infernal, Primordial, telepathy 120 ft.
Challenge 23 (50,000 XP)
Amphibious. The kraken can breathe air and water.
Freedom of Movement. The kraken ignores difficult terrain, and magical effects can't reduce its speed or cause it to be restrained.
Siege Monster. The kraken deals double damage to objects and structures.
Actions
Multiattack. The kraken makes three tentacle attacks, each of which it can replace with one use of Fling.
Bite. Melee Weapon Attack: +17 to hit, reach 5 ft., one target. Hit: 23 (3d8 + 10) piercing damage. If the target is a Large or smaller creature grappled by the kraken, that creature is swallowed.
Tentacle. Melee Weapon Attack: +17 to hit, reach 30 ft., one target. Hit: 20 (3d6 + 10) bludgeoning damage, and the target is grappled (escape DC 18).
Fling. One Large or smaller object held or creature grappled by the kraken is thrown up to 60 feet in a random direction and knocked prone.
Lightning Storm. The kraken magically creates three bolts of lightning, each of which can strike a target the kraken can see within 120 feet. A target must make a DC 23 Dexterity saving throw, taking 22 (4d10) lightning damage on a failed save, or half as much on a successful one.
Legendary Actions
The kraken can take 3 legendary actions, choosing from the options below. Only one legendary action option can be used at a time and only at the end of another creature's turn. The kraken regains spent legendary actions at the start of its turn.
Tentacle Attack or Fling. The kraken makes one tentacle attack or uses its Fling.
Lightning Storm (Costs 2 Actions). The kraken uses Lightning Storm.
Ink Cloud (Costs 3 Actions). While underwater, the kraken expels an ink cloud in a 60-foot radius. The cloud spreads around corners, and that area is heavily obscured to creatures other than the kraken.
